Setting Sail from Chania’s Old Port
Your journey begins at the historic Old Port of Chania, which sets the perfect scene for a relaxing evening. You’re advised to arrive about 15 minutes early, to meet the crew with the DanEri flag ready to board the luxurious catamaran. The vessel itself looks the part—spacious, comfortable, and designed for smooth sailing. The crew, who are certified by the Red Cross, seem committed to making your experience smooth and enjoyable right from the start.
The Itinerary – A Well-Structured Cruise
The cruise starts with a brief stop at the Old Venetian Harbour, where guests get to enjoy local snacks, a safety briefing, and welcome refreshments. This short 15-minute pause is a nice touch—it helps everyone settle in and get a taste of local flavors before heading out to sea.
Next, you’ll spend around 75 minutes sailing along Crete’s coast on the catamaran. The boat is designed for comfort, with plenty of space to lounge, take photos, or simply soak in the views. The crew’s friendly attitude shines here, making you feel welcomed and cared for.
The highlight of the trip is the stop at Agioi Theodoroi, approximately one hour long. This part of the cruise is packed with activities: you can snap photos of the scenic bay bathed in sunset light, enjoy local wine and beers, swim in the clear waters, or try snorkeling with provided gear. For families or kids, inflatables and toys are available, adding a playful touch to the evening. Paddleboarding is also included, giving a fun way to explore the calm waters.
After soaking up the scenery and enjoying some leisure time, you’ll cruise back on the same elegant vessel for another 75-minute sail, heading towards the port as the sky transitions into a golden glow. The whole trip, including stops and sailing, lasts around 3.5 hours, fitting nicely into an evening plan.
The All-Inclusive Aspect – Drinks and Snacks
What makes this tour stand out is its focus on comfort. Throughout the cruise, soft drinks, chilled white Cretan wine, and local beer flow freely. The reviews confirm that the crew is attentive in keeping everyone refreshed. Plus, local cheeses, snacks, and fresh fruits are served, elevating the experience from just a boat ride to a mini picnic at sea.

Considerations and Downsides
The main consideration is the weather, as with all sailing trips. If conditions aren’t ideal, the cruise could be rescheduled or canceled. Also, since the tour involves a fair amount of time on the water, those prone to seasickness might want to consider this before booking.
Another point is the lack of hotel pickup unless you specifically select the transfer option. If you don’t opt for the transfer service, you’ll need to meet directly at the port 15 minutes early. For anyone with mobility concerns, it’s worth verifying accessibility, though the vessel itself is described as wheelchair accessible.
